📄 paycash.aspx
字号:
'删除操作
cnn=new sqlconnection(configurationsettings.appsettings("connection"))
cnn.open()
sql="delete from paycashsheet where code='" & trim(codestr) & "'"
cmd=new sqlcommand(sql,cnn)
cmd.executeNonQuery
cnn.close
bindgrid()
end if
End Sub
Sub Grid1_Update(Sender as object,E as DataGridCommandEventArgs)
dim ModMoney As String=CType(E.Item.Cells(3).Controls(0),TextBox).Text
dim CashMode as string=CType(E.Item.Cells(4).Controls(0),textBox).Text
dim Fphstr as string=CType(E.Item.Cells(5).Controls(0),textBox).Text
dim Memostr as string=CType(E.Item.Cells(6).Controls(0),textBox).Text
dim CodeStr as String=E.Item.Cells(0).Text
dim theDiscount as single
dim sql as string
if Isnumeric(modmoney) then
cnn=new sqlconnection(configurationsettings.appsettings("connection"))
cnn.open()
sql="update paycashsheet set paymoney=" & csng(modmoney) & ",paymode='" & trim(cashmode) & "',fph='" & trim(fphstr) & "',memo='" & trim(memostr) & "' where code='" & codestr & "'"
cmd=new sqlcommand(sql,cnn)
cmd.executeNonQuery
cnn.close()
end if
DataGrid1.EditItemIndex=-1
BindGrid()
Requiredfieldvalidator1.Enabled=True
Requiredfieldvalidator2.Enabled=True
End Sub
Sub Grid1_Cancel(Sender as object,E as DataGridCommandEventArgs)
Requiredfieldvalidator1.Enabled=True
Requiredfieldvalidator2.Enabled=True
datagrid1.EditItemIndex=-1
BindGrid()
End Sub
Sub Grid1_Edit(Sender as object,E as DataGridCommandEventArgs)
Requiredfieldvalidator1.Enabled=False
Requiredfieldvalidator2.Enabled=False
DataGrid1.EditItemIndex=E.Item.ItemIndex
BindGrid()
End Sub
Sub Grid1_PageIndexChanged(Sender As Object, E As DataGridPageChangedEventArgs)
datagrid1.CurrentPageIndex = e.NewPageIndex
BindGrid()
End Sub
Function GetAlertInfo(byval str1 as string) as String
dim Str2 as String
str2="<script language='javascript'>alert('" & str1 & "')<"
str2+="/"
str2+="script>"
return trim(str2)
End Function
</script>
<html>
<head>
<title>用户信息</title>
<link href="../Main.css" type="text/css" rel="stylesheet" />
</head>
<body>
<form runat="server">
<b>付款信息增加</b>
<hr size="1" />
<table class="table1" id="table1" cellspacing="1" cellpadding="0" width="95%" align="center" border="0">
<tbody>
<tr class="tr2">
<td style="PADDING-LEFT: 5px" colspan="3" height="25">
请选择付款单位:
<asp:DropDownList class="input_text" id="SelProvider" runat="server" width="200"></asp:DropDownList>
<asp:button class="input_button" id="JSBtn" onclick="JS_Click" runat="server" CausesValidation="false" text="计算款项"></asp:button>
</td>
</tr>
<tr class="tr1">
<td style="PADDING-LEFT: 5px" colspan="3" height="25">
<b>款项信息:<asp:Label id="Label1" runat="server" forecolor="Blue"></asp:Label></b></td>
</tr>
</tbody>
</table>
<table class="table_1" id="table2" cellspacing="1" cellpadding="0" width="95%" align="center">
<tbody>
<tr class="tr2">
<td style="PADDING-LEFT: 5px" width="30%" height="25">
付款时间:
<asp:TextBox class="input_text" id="DDate" runat="server" width="100"></asp:TextBox>
<asp:RequiredFieldValidator id="RequiredFieldValidator1" runat="server" ErrorMessage="必 填" ControlToValidate="DDate"></asp:RequiredFieldValidator>
</td>
<td style="PADDING-LEFT: 5px" width="30%" height="25">
付款金额:
<asp:TextBox class="input_text" id="TxtCash" runat="server" width="100"></asp:TextBox>
<asp:RequiredFieldValidator id="RequiredFieldValidator2" runat="server" ErrorMessage="*" ControlToValidate="TxtCash">必填</asp:RequiredFieldValidator>
</td>
<td style="PADDING-LEFT: 5px" width="40%" height="25">
付款方式:
<asp:DropDownList class="input_text" id="SelCashMode" runat="server" width="100">
<asp:ListItem Value="现金" Selected="True">现金</asp:ListItem>
<asp:ListItem Value="汇款">汇款</asp:ListItem>
<asp:ListItem Value="支票">支票</asp:ListItem>
<asp:ListItem Value="转账">转账</asp:ListItem>
<asp:ListItem Value="电汇">电汇</asp:ListItem>
<asp:ListItem Value="托收">托收</asp:ListItem>
</asp:DropDownList>
</td>
</tr>
<tr class="tr1">
<td style="PADDING-LEFT: 5px" height="25">
发 票 号:
<asp:TextBox class="input_text" id="TxtFph" runat="server" width="100"></asp:TextBox>
</td>
<td style="PADDING-LEFT: 5px" colspan="2" height="25">
备 注:
<asp:TextBox class="input_text" id="TxtMemo" runat="server" width="337"></asp:TextBox>
<input class="input_button" id="clear" type="reset" value="清 空" runat="server" />
<asp:button class="input_button" id="SaveBtn" onclick="Save_Click" runat="server" text="保 存"></asp:button>
</td>
</tr>
</tbody>
</table>
<br />
<b>付款信息查询</b>
<hr size="1" />
<table class="" id="search" cellspacing="1" cellpadding="0" width="95%" align="center" border="0">
<tbody>
<tr class="tr2">
<td style="PADDING-LEFT: 5px" height="25">
检索条件:
<asp:DropDownList class="input_text" id="query_tj" runat="server" width="97">
<asp:ListItem Value="a.code" Selected="True">付款单编码</asp:ListItem>
<asp:ListItem Value="b.abbrname">供应商</asp:ListItem>
<asp:ListItem Value="fph">发票号</asp:ListItem>
</asp:DropDownList>
检索内容:
<asp:TextBox class="input_text" id="query_content" runat="server" width="120"></asp:TextBox>
<asp:button class="input_button" id="QueryBtn" onclick="Query_Click" runat="server" CausesValidation="False" text="查 询"></asp:button>
<br />
<b><asp:Label id="Msg" runat="server" forecolor="red"></asp:Label></b></td>
</tr>
<tr>
<td style="PADDING-LEFT: 5px" height="25">
<asp:DataGrid id="DataGrid1" runat="server" width="100%" PageSize="12" AutoGenerateColumns="False" OnItemCommand="Grid1_Del" OnupdateCommand="Grid1_Update" OnCancelCommand="Grid1_Cancel" OnEditCommand="Grid1_Edit" headerstyle-backcolor="#F8FAFC" font-size="8pt" font-name="verdana" cellpadding="2" bordercolor="Black" Font-Names="verdana" AllowPaging="True" AllowSorting="True" OnPageIndexChanged="Grid1_PageIndexChanged">
<HeaderStyle font-bold="True" horizontalalign="Center" verticalalign="Middle" backcolor="#F8FAFC"></HeaderStyle>
<PagerStyle nextpagetext="下一页" font-names="宋体" font-bold="True" prevpagetext="上一页" horizontalalign="Right" forecolor="Blue" mode="NumericPages"></PagerStyle>
<Columns>
<asp:BoundColumn DataField="Code" ReadOnly="True" HeaderText="付款单编码"></asp:BoundColumn>
<asp:BoundColumn DataField="ddate" ReadOnly="True" HeaderText="付款日期" DataFormatString="{0:d}"></asp:BoundColumn>
<asp:BoundColumn DataField="providername" ReadOnly="True" HeaderText="供应商"></asp:BoundColumn>
<asp:BoundColumn DataField="paymoney" HeaderText="付款金额"></asp:BoundColumn>
<asp:BoundColumn DataField="paymode" HeaderText="付款方式"></asp:BoundColumn>
<asp:BoundColumn DataField="fph" HeaderText="发票号"></asp:BoundColumn>
<asp:BoundColumn DataField="memo" HeaderText="备注"></asp:BoundColumn>
<asp:EditCommandColumn ButtonType="LinkButton" UpdateText="更新" HeaderText="编辑" CancelText="取消" EditText="编辑"></asp:EditCommandColumn>
<asp:ButtonColumn Text="删除" HeaderText="删除" CommandName="delete"></asp:ButtonColumn>
</Columns>
</asp:DataGrid>
</td>
</tr>
</tbody>
</table>
</form>
</body>
</html>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-